    • Certificate IIICabinet Making and Timber Technology (Furniture)

      MSF30322-04

      Gain national recognition as a trade qualified cabinet maker. Apply practical skills to build, create and install furniture pieces for clients. Choose to work in commercial or residential spaces, or even start your own business.

    How do I enrol?

    At TAFE NSW you can apply or enrol to do a course.

    If your course has no entry requirements, you can enrol directly. If there are entry requirements, you will need to apply to be accepted for a position in the course.

    1. Go to the TAFE NSW website to view the course you are interested in
    2. Check if there are any entry requirements, as you may be asked to supply additional information
    3. Select a course location to progress your enrolment
    4. Follow the prompts to complete
    5. You will receive an email confirming your enrolment or application status

    If you need further assistance with your enrolment, contact TAFE NSW Student Services on 131 601 between 8.30am-5pm Monday to Friday.
